Key Factors to Consider

Budget

Deciding on a realistic budget early is crucial as it will guide your choices for the venue, catering, attire, and other expenses.

Date and Season

Choose a date considering seasonality and special timing, such as sunset for outdoor ceremonies.

Venue

Assess venue capacity, rental fees, included services, parking, accessibility, restroom availability (at least 4 restrooms per 100 guests), on-site accommodations or nearby hotels, noise restrictions, and facilities for cocktail hour or entertainment.

Guest List

Finalize the guest list to match venue capacity and budget. It is acceptable to exclude guests who are not wanted at the wedding.

Theme and Style

Pick a theme or vibe that reflects your personalities and desired atmosphere.

Logistics

Consider sound systems, power outlets for vendors, transportation options (including rideshare accessibility and shuttle services), and accommodations for guests with disabilities.

Planning Timeline

Use a structured timeline or checklist, like sending save-the-dates, booking photographers, finalizing the menu, and arranging trials several months ahead.

Sustainability

Think about venue recycling policies or eco-friendly practices if you want your wedding to be environmentally conscious.
